## Android → PC
|
|
|
|
Android produces:
|
|
|
|
```text
|
|
Download/Trainlog/trainlog-mobile-export-v1.json
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
The desktop retrieves it through direct libmtp.
|
|
|
|
No GVFS/FUSE mount is used.
|
|
|
|
The desktop importer:
|
|
|
|
```text
|
|
tools/import_mobile_export.py
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
is:
|
|
|
|
```text
|
|
strict
|
|
transactional
|
|
idempotent by stable IDs
|
|
profile-aware
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
Validated behavior:
|
|
|
|
```text
|
|
first import:
|
|
new exercise/session/body observation imported
|
|
|
|
second import:
|
|
no duplicates
|
|
existing stable IDs skipped
|
|
```

## PC → Android
|
|
|
|
The desktop produces:
|
|
|
|
```text
|
|
/tmp/trainlog-pc-catalog-v1.json
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
with:
|
|
|
|
```text
|
|
format = trainlog-pc-catalog
|
|
version = 1
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
The catalog is published by direct MTP to:
|
|
|
|
```text
|
|
Download/Trainlog/trainlog-pc-catalog-v1.json
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
Physical-device publication has been validated.
|
|
|
|
The Android application accesses the PC-created file through one persistent
|
|
Storage Access Framework grant.
|
|
|
|
The selected folder must be:
|
|
|
|
```text
|
|
Download/Trainlog
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
The Sync screen must always allow changing this folder because a wrong
|
|
persisted SAF grant must be recoverable without clearing application data.

## Important semantics
|
|
|
|
The synchronization layer exchanges versioned Trainlog domain artifacts.
|
|
|
|
It does not synchronize SQLite files.
|
|
|
|
The frozen legacy session format remains:
|
|
|
|
```text
|
|
TRAINLOG_FORMAT_V1=FROZEN
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
Profile-aware synchronization uses separate explicit synchronization artifacts.

## Android-triggered synchronization
|
|
|
|
The final Android Sync UX must not require:
|
|
|
|
```text
|
|
Prepare export
|
|
then use the PC manually
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
Target behavior:
|
|
|
|
```text
|
|
Android data change
|
|
-> mobile snapshot maintained automatically
|
|
|
|
Android "Synchronize now"
|
|
-> synchronization request
|
|
|
|
PC trainlog-syncd
|
|
-> detects request over direct MTP
|
|
-> runs the same bidirectional sync engine
|
|
-> writes synchronization receipt
|
|
|
|
Android
|
|
-> reads receipt
|
|
-> applies PC catalog
|
|
-> displays final synchronization result
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
MTP remains host-initiated. Therefore Android-triggered synchronization needs
|
|
a small PC-side agent; it cannot directly command libmtp operations on the PC.
